American parents have registered 133,184 Graysons since 1880, against 1,080 Graftons. Grayson is still ahead, with 5,857 babies in 2025.

Each line is every baby given the name that year, girls and boys added together — the only count that means the same thing for both names. A line breaks where the name fell below five babies in a year — the point at which the SSA stops publishing it — rather than being drawn through a figure nobody published. A single published year in a gap shows as a dot.

Who was ahead

Of the 122 years in which either name was published, Grayson for 116 years and Grafton for 6 years. The lead changed hands 7 times.

Which name is older

Half of the Graftons alive today are over 27; half the Graysons are over 8. That is 19 years between them: two names in use at the same time, worn by two different generations.
